This is also happening in Ubuntu Trusty 14.04.3 LTS : right after
installing fglrx-updates and fglrx-amdcccle-updates the virtual consoles
become unusable, i.e. totally blank.

Again, as bad as the AMD support for Linux may be, as a matter of fact
the proprietary driver is (unfortunately) still better then its open
source counterpart: display quality is noticeably better, screen
adjustments are way easier and more fine tunable than messing around
with xrandr, composite window  managers don't work properly or don't
work at all  with the open source driver.

Much as I would like to do without the proprietary AMD driver, I need to
use it to have my hardware working as I want, so please fix this issue.
